What Does MVNT Do?
Movement Industries Corporation, formerly known as Visual Healthcare Corp., transitioned to its current focus in August 2019. The company provides computer numerically controlled (CNC) machining and fabrication services, along with valves, primarily serving organizations within the energy sector. Based in Houston, Texas, Movement Industries Corporation operates as a subsidiary of LTN Capital Ventures, LLC. The company's services cater to the specific needs of the oil and gas industry, providing essential components and machining solutions. With a small team of four employees, Movement Industries Corporation focuses on specialized services within its niche market. The company's evolution reflects a strategic shift towards industrial services, leveraging CNC machining and fabrication capabilities to support the energy sector. MVNT OTC Market Information
The OTC Other tier represents the lowest tier of the OTC market, indicating that Movement Industries Corporation may not meet the minimum financial standards or reporting requirements of higher tiers like OTCQX or OTCQB. Companies in this tier often have limited trading volume and liquidity, and may not be required to provide audited financial statements. Investing in OTC Other stocks carries significant risks due to the lack of regulatory oversight and transparency compared to exchanges like the NYSE or NASDAQ. This tier is often populated by shell companies, defunct businesses, or companies with questionable financials.
